Quick Answer
No. Running a lighter over a frayed seatbelt is not an approved repair method. It melts the surface fibres but does nothing for the webbing underneath. The belt is still damaged — and a roadworthy inspector will still fail it.

Why People Try the Lighter Trick
We completely understand why people try this. Nobody wants to replace an expensive safety component if they don’t have to, and the internet is full of DIY suggestions that sound convincing. Someone reads advice online, or a workmate says “just run a lighter over it.” The frayed fibres melt back and the edge looks tidier. At first glance it looks like it worked.
Then it fails the roadworthy inspection anyway — because inspectors are not looking at the edge from a distance. They are checking the condition of the webbing itself.
The other common attempts we see are trimming the frayed edge with scissors, applying glue or tape, or using a heat gun instead of a lighter. The result is the same in every case: the underlying damage remains, and the belt still fails.

| What We Commonly See | Why It Matters |
|---|---|
| Lighter used to melt frayed fibres | The most common DIY attempt. The surface looks tidier but the underlying fibres are still broken — and the heat has often spread further than the original fraying. The belt still fails inspection. |
| Frayed edge trimmed with scissors | Cutting the edge does not repair the weave. It removes the visible fraying but leaves the webbing weakened and still unroadworthy. Inspectors check the webbing condition, not just the edge. |
| Glue or tape applied to the damaged area | Adhesives do not restore webbing strength and are clearly visible during inspection. Tape leaves residue that can make professional re-webbing more difficult. |
| Heat gun used instead of a lighter | A heat gun causes the same problem as a lighter but often over a wider area. The fibres are melted rather than repaired and the damage is more extensive by the time the belt reaches us. |
Why the Lighter Trick Does Not Work
Seatbelt webbing is woven polyester. The fibres are what give it strength. When you run a lighter over frayed webbing, you are melting the surface — not repairing the weave. Underneath, the fibres are still broken.
The Webbing Is Weaker, Not Stronger
Heat damages the fibres it touches. The belt may look tidier but it has lost strength where it matters. The underlying damage remains.
Inspectors Know What Heat Damage Looks Like
Burn marks, gloss on the webbing surface, discolouration and stiff sections are all visible signs. Heat damage will not get past a roadworthy check.
It Is a Safety Issue, Not Just Compliance
A heat-damaged seatbelt may not perform correctly in a crash. That is the real problem — not just whether it passes an inspection.
It Can Affect Your Insurance
Attempting a non-approved repair to a safety component can create issues with your insurer if there is ever a claim involving the seatbelt.

What Roadworthy Inspectors Actually Look For
Inspectors check the full length of the webbing — fraying, cuts, tears, burns, chemical damage and excessive wear. Heat damage from a lighter shows up clearly. There is no DIY method that gets around this. The inspection covers the webbing condition, not just whether it looks tidy from a distance.
Common DIY attempts we see in our workshop: using a lighter, using a soldering iron, cutting the frayed edge with scissors, applying glue, burning loose fibres with a heat gun, or covering damage with tape. None of these fix the webbing. Most make the job harder when the belt eventually comes in for proper repair.

The Right Way to Fix a Frayed Seatbelt
If the damage is limited to the webbing, re-webbing is usually the appropriate option. We remove the old webbing, fit new compliant material, and the existing hardware may be retained where appropriate following inspection. This is generally faster and more cost-effective than replacing the whole assembly.
Before fitting new webbing, we inspect the retractor, hardware and operation of the complete assembly. If the retractor or hardware has issues, or if the damage is too extensive, we explain that clearly before any work is done.
A customer posted us a front seatbelt that had been fraying at the edge for some time. Before sending it in, they had run a lighter along the frayed section to tidy it up. When we inspected the webbing, the heat damage had spread well beyond the original fraying — the fibres were fused and hardened across a wider area than the customer had realised.
The original fraying would have been a straightforward re-webbing job. With the additional heat damage, the assessment took longer and the extent of the affected webbing was greater. New replacement webbing was fitted, the retractor inspected and cleaned, and the completed assembly returned the following business day.
It is a good example of why a lighter makes the job harder, not easier — and why the belt should come to us before any DIY attempt is made.

Frequently Asked Questions
Will a lighter fix a frayed seatbelt for roadworthy?
No. Running a lighter over frayed webbing melts the surface fibres but does not repair the underlying damage. Roadworthy inspectors check the condition of the webbing itself and heat damage is clearly visible. The belt will still fail.
Can I burn a seatbelt to fix fraying?
No. Whether you use a lighter, a heat gun or a soldering iron, the result is the same — the surface fibres melt but the underlying damage remains. Heat also permanently weakens the polyester fibres it contacts, making the webbing less safe than before.
Can I cut the frayed edge with scissors?
No. Cutting the frayed edge does not repair the webbing and may make the damage worse. It is not an approved repair method and will not pass a roadworthy inspection.
Can I melt seatbelt fibres to stop fraying?
No. Melting the fibres — whether with a lighter, heat gun or other heat source — does not repair the webbing. It fuses the surface while leaving the underlying fibres broken and the belt structurally compromised.
What does heat damage look like to an inspector?
Heat damage typically appears as melted or fused fibres, a glossy or hardened surface, discolouration and stiff sections in the webbing. These signs are clearly visible during a roadworthy inspection.
